Smart Planning & Freezer Stocking Tips for Week 40
To maximize your efficiency and minimize waste this week, consider these helpful meal prep and freezer tips. A well-stocked freezer is a true game-changer for busy weeknights, offering quick solutions when time is tight.
- Ground Beef Prep: If your freezer already holds cooked ground beef, this is the perfect week to utilize it for the Easy Skillet Ramen on Day 1, cutting down on cooking time significantly. If not, consider cooking a larger batch of ground beef early in the week. Use what you need for the ramen and then freeze the remainder in portioned bags to replenish your freezer stock, ensuring future meals are even faster to prepare.
- Pinto Bean Power: Day 3 features hearty Pinto Beans. This is an excellent opportunity to cook an extra-large batch. Pinto beans freeze exceptionally well, and having them ready to go means you can quickly assemble future meals like burritos, soups, or another round of delicious beans over cornbread with minimal effort. Simply cool completely, then store in freezer-safe containers or bags.
- Freezer-Friendly Tortellini Zucchini Soup: On Day 4, you’ll be making Tortellini Zucchini Soup, a delightful and comforting dish. This soup is a fantastic candidate for freezer stocking! Doubling or even tripling the recipe will allow you to enjoy it later on a busy night, or simply have a quick, homemade meal ready for unexpected occasions. Just remember to cool the soup completely before freezing to maintain its quality and flavor.

Day 1: Easy Skillet Ramen & Broccoli Salad
Kick off your week with a burst of flavor and ultimate convenience with our Easy Skillet Ramen, perfectly complemented by a fresh and crunchy Broccoli Salad. This meal is designed for busy weeknights, proving that delicious home-cooked food doesn’t have to take hours.
The Easy Skillet Ramen is a standout for its simplicity and incredible flavor. This one-pan wonder combines tender ramen noodles with savory ground beef, vibrant diced tomatoes, sweet corn, and green peas, all seasoned to perfection. It’s a fantastic way to elevate instant ramen into a wholesome, family-approved dish in minutes. Using pre-cooked ground beef from your freezer makes this meal even quicker, allowing you to have dinner on the table in about 15-20 minutes. It’s truly a frugal and kid-friendly option that doesn’t compromise on taste. Paired with a crisp Broccoli Salad, you get a delightful balance of textures and nutrients, making for a truly satisfying start to your week.
Day 2: Santa Fe Chicken & Homemade Guacamole with Tortilla Chips
Tuesday brings a taste of the Southwest to your dinner table with our delightful Santa Fe Chicken, served alongside fresh Homemade Guacamole and crispy Tortilla Chips. This meal is packed with zesty flavors and offers a satisfying, wholesome experience for the whole family.
Our Santa Fe Chicken recipe features tender chicken breasts coated in savory cracker crumbs, then baked to perfection with a generous topping of zesty salsa and a melted Mexican cheese blend. The combination creates a moist, flavorful chicken dish that’s both easy to prepare and incredibly satisfying. The vibrant flavors of the salsa and cheese elevate simple baked chicken into a delicious, crowd-pleasing meal. To complete this Southwestern feast, serve it with freshly made Homemade Guacamole and crunchy Tortilla Chips. Preparing your own guacamole is surprisingly simple and tastes far superior to store-bought versions, offering a creamy, tangy counterpoint to the savory chicken. Day 4: Tortellini Zucchini Soup & Italian Bread
As the week progresses, warm up with a bowl of our incredibly flavorful and easy-to-make Tortellini Zucchini Soup, perfectly paired with a crusty slice of Italian Bread. This soup is a testament to how simple ingredients can come together to create a profoundly satisfying and comforting meal, ideal for a cozy evening.
Our Tortellini Zucchini Soup is a culinary gem, boasting a rich, savory broth, tender zucchini, and plump, cheese-filled tortellini. It’s a surprisingly quick recipe, often ready in just 20 minutes, making it an ideal choice when you need a delicious meal in a hurry. The fresh zucchini adds a delightful texture and healthy boost, while the tortellini makes it wonderfully filling. This soup is so good, you’ll likely want to make a double or triple batch, not just for the immediate satisfaction but also because it freezes exceptionally well. Having a stash of homemade soup in your freezer is a meal-prepping superpower, ready for those days when cooking isn’t an option. Serve this comforting soup with a warm loaf of Italian Bread, perfect for soaking up every last drop of the flavorful broth.
Day 5: Slow Cooker Sweet and Sour Chicken over Rice & Egg Drop Soup
Wrap up your week with an effortless and incredibly satisfying meal from the Slow Cooker: Sweet and Sour Chicken served over fluffy white rice, complemented by a delicate Egg Drop Soup. This Friday feast promises maximum flavor with minimal effort, allowing you to enjoy your evening.
The Slow Cooker Sweet and Sour Chicken is the epitome of set-it-and-forget-it cooking. A little prep in the morning transforms into a magnificent dinner by evening. Tender chicken pieces are simmered in a vibrant, tangy sweet and sour sauce with colorful bell peppers and juicy pineapple, creating a harmonious blend of flavors. Served over a bed of fluffy white rice, this Asian-inspired dish is both incredibly satisfying and wonderfully balanced. It’s a fantastic meal for winding down the week, requiring minimal hands-on time during dinner rush. To complete this delicious meal, we’ve included Egg Drop Soup, a light and comforting Chinese soup that adds an authentic touch. Its delicate texture and savory broth perfectly complement the robust flavors of the sweet and sour chicken. This combination makes for a truly delightful and fuss-free Friday night dinner.
